Question 1033428: You have $36 to spend on posters for your bedroom you can buy a small poster X for four dollars and a large poster Y for six dollars. Write an equation that models the different number of posters you can buy.
Answer by addingup(3677) (Show Source): You can put this solution on YOUR website!
4x+6y=36
